4 Iris Ct, Kingston is a 3 bedroom, 2 bathroom House with 1 parking spaces and was built in 2001. The property has a land size of 620m2 and floor size of 126m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in October 2024.

The size of Kingston is approximately 37.3 square kilometres. It has 29 parks covering nearly 8.9% of total area. The population of Kingston in 2016 was 10409 people. By 2021 the population was 12288 showing a population growth of 18.0%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Kingston is 30-39 years. Households in Kingston are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Kingston work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 67.90% of the homes in Kingston were owner-occupied compared with 67.30% in 2016.
